// Implements the modulo operation. E.g. modulo(10, 7) == 3, modulo(-1, 7) == 6.
int Modulo(int dividend, int divisor) {
int remainder = dividend % divisor;
if (remainder < 0)
remainder += divisor;
return remainder;
}

// Test if an overnight time window limit applies to the following day.
TEST_F(UsageTimeLimitProcessorTest, GetStateWithPreviousDayTimeWindowLimit) {
std::unique_ptr<icu::TimeZone> timezone(icu::TimeZone::createTimeZone("GMT"));
// Setup time window limit.
std::string last_updated = CreatePolicyTimestamp("1 Jan 2018 8:00 GMT");
base::Value saturday_time_limit =
CreateTimeWindow(base::Value("SATURDAY"), CreateTime(21, 0),
CreateTime(8, 30), base::Value(last_updated));
base::Value window_limit_entries(base::Value::Type::LIST);
window_limit_entries.GetList().push_back(std::move(saturday_time_limit));
base::Value time_window_limit(base::Value::Type::DICTIONARY);
time_window_limit.SetKey("entries", std::move(window_limit_entries));
// Setup time usage limit.
base::Value time_usage_limit = base::Value(base::Value::Type::DICTIONARY);
time_usage_limit.SetKey("reset_at", CreateTime(8, 0));
// Setup policy.
std::unique_ptr<base::Value> time_limit =
std::make_unique<base::Value>(base::Value::Type::DICTIONARY);
time_limit->SetKey("time_window_limit", std::move(time_window_limit));
time_limit->SetKey("time_usage_limit", std::move(time_usage_limit));
std::unique_ptr<base::DictionaryValue> time_limit_dictionary =
base::DictionaryValue::From(std::move(time_limit));
// Check that device is locked.
base::Time time_one = TimeFromString("Sun, 7 Jan 2018 8:00 GMT");
State state_one =
GetState(time_limit_dictionary, base::TimeDelta::FromMinutes(80),
time_one, time_one, timezone.get(), base::nullopt);
State expected_state_one;
expected_state_one.is_locked = true;
expected_state_one.active_policy = ActivePolicies::kFixedLimit;
expected_state_one.is_time_usage_limit_enabled = false;
expected_state_one.next_state_change_time =
TimeFromString("Sun, 7 Jan 2018 8:30 GMT");
expected_state_one.next_state_active_policy = ActivePolicies::kNoActivePolicy;
expected_state_one.next_unlock_time =
TimeFromString("Sun, 7 Jan 2018 8:30 GMT");
expected_state_one.last_state_changed = base::Time();
AssertEqState(expected_state_one, state_one);
}
